VERY SHORT QUESTIONS AND ANSWERS

1.) Who is Wanda Petronski?

Ans: Wanda Petronski is a Polish girl who has migrated to America.

2.) Why was Wanda’s presence and even absence never noticed?

Ans: Wanda’s presence and absence were never noticed, for she was a quiet girl who would sit in the corner of the class.

3.) How do you describe Peggy?

Ans: Peggy was one of the prettiest and the most popular girls in the school.

4.) Who was Maddie’s best friend?

Ans: Peggy was Maddie’s best friend.

5.) How did Peggy make fun of Wanda?

Ans: Peggy made fun of Wanda by asking her about the hundred dresses.

SHORT QUESTIONS AND ANSWERS

1.) Why did Maddie not like Peggy’s humiliation for Wanda?

Ans: Just like Wanda, Maddie, too, was a poor girl, and she always feared that she would be the other target for humiliation. And this is the reason why she did not like Peggy’s humiliation for Wanda.

2.) What made Peggy think that Wanda lied when she said she had a hundred dresses?

Ans: Peggy thought Wanda lied when she said she had a hundred dresses because she was poor and came from Boggins Heights when a loosely hung dress and shoes with mud and dirt.

3.) Why did everyone in the class think that Wanda was different?

Ans: Everyone in the class thought Wanda was different because she had a very different name, unlike others in the class. She also wore a pale blue loose dress, which also did not look properly ironed. She sat in the corner of the class and was hardly noticed, except when Peggy decided to humiliate her.

4.) Write a few lines about Peggy.

Ans: Peggy was the most popular and the most beautiful girl in the class. She was not a bully, as she would never disrespect people and would be hurt if some animal got hurt. But she felt Wanda kept on lying about the hundred dresses, which annoyed her, and that is why she would keep humiliating her.

5.) Who was the winner of the drawing contest?

Ans: The winner of the drawing contest was Wanda, who had drawn exquisite dresses, a hundred of them. Everyone was left awestruck after looking at her drawings

ESSAY TYPE QUESTIONS

1.) How do you think Maddie and Peggy were different despite being the best of friends?

Ans: Maddie and Peggy were completely different personalities despite being the best of friends. Peggy was one of the richest and the most popular girls, who wore amazing clothes and had many good shoes, while Maddie came from a poor background and wore Peggy’s used clothes. She was not as popular as Peggy and was only known because she was Peggy’s best friend. She was also not happy with the way Peggy treated Wanda because she feared that Peggy would make her the next target someday. But Peggy would tease Wanda because she thought she was a liar. Both the girls came from completely different backgrounds and had completely different thoughts as well.

2.) What made Maddie think that Peggy would win the drawing competition? What was the students’ reaction, especially Peggy and Maddie, when Wanda won the drawing competition? Why?

Ans: Maddie thought Peggy would win the drawing competition because she was a skilled artist, as she could easily draw any sketch by just looking at its original form in a magazine or a book. When Wanda won the drawing competition, everyone was shocked to see her exquisite drawings of the hundred dresses with vibrant colors. Peggy and Maddie were shocked as they never thought of Wanda as a good artist. Every student was going through her drawing with wide eyes, wondering how the weird name girl could win the competition. Peggy never thought that Wanda would be such an amazing artist, for she always cornered her and made fun of her when she said she had a hundred dresses.
